Check out Luna, which has recently smashed its fundraising goal on IndieGoGo. Its a mattress cover that is packed with sensors and will, the makers claim, help you sleep better.

Whilst you sleep it will monitor your heart rate, breathing rate and sleep cycle, and will adjust the temperature of the bed to optimise your sleep. Brilliantly for couples, it can warm both sides of the bed independently so you can have it how you like it.

There’s also a smart alarm function built into the associated app, which will wake you up gently when it detects light sleeping, and the app will also integrate with your other internet-of-things devices to, say, switch off all of your lights when you go to sleep or start up the wifi coffee machine in the morning.

Sounds pretty clever, right? Luna looks set to set you back about $200 (about £130) when it launches in August.
